The purpose of this study is to compare and interpret some of the motifs of Besarani and Rumi. Despite the differences in expression and worldly style, these motifs are somewhat close in context and are an illustration of the intertextual language of the two poets. Although this topic is widespread and requires further investigation; However, this category of images and their meanings can be a tool for identifying artistic, linguistic and intellectual functions and guiding their reactions and influences. In the duet of Rumi's texts, some literary signs and materials are seen as the dominant literary scene that shows the influence of Besarani on this poet. In addition, it appears that Besarani's simple form of expression and Rumi's style are deeper and more multidimensional. Another point worth mentioning; Both poets have had a path in the Kurdish poetry movement and have had a good linguistic, literary and intellectual influence on the structure of literary history
